distance between the parallel planes `ax+by+ cz + d =0 and ax+by + cz + d' =0` is

A

`(|d+d|)/( sqrt( a^(2) + b^(2) + c^(2) )`

B

`(|d-d'|)/( sqrt(a^(2) + b^(2) + c^(2) )`

C

`(d)/( sqrt( a^(2) + b^(2) + c^(2) ) )`

D

none of these

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
B
